The following guide shows how to read and write the FAW Continental SID605 ECU using the OBDSTAR ECU MASTER.
Required Tools
Before getting started, prepare the following:
OBDSTAR ECU MASTER
FAW Continental SID605 (SPC564A80) ECU
Computer
High-Power DC Power Supply
USB Cable
Jumper Wires
Step 1. Connect the ECU MASTER
Connect the ECU MASTER to your computer using a USB cable.
Step 2. Select the ECU Model
Open ECU Flasher → HD → ECM.
Search for the ECU model in the upper-right corner and select FAW SID605.
Step 3. Enter BOOT Mode
Tap Start → BOOT → OK.
Step 4. Check the Wiring Information
Tap Guide to view detailed connection instructions and adapter information.
You can also tap:
ECU Image to view the ECU appearance.
Connector Pinout to check the connector wiring.
PCB Pinout to view the PCB wiring diagram.
Carefully inspect the ECU circuit board before making the connections.
Step 5. Connect the ECU
Connect the wiring according to the connector pinout diagram.
Tap Connect, then tap Yes when prompted.
Once connected successfully, the connection status will be displayed in the left panel.
Step 6. Read the ECU Data
Read INT FLASH
Tap Read INT FLASH.
You can rename the file and choose the save location before reading.
When the process is complete, the left panel will display a successful message.
Read EXT EEPROM
Tap Read EXT EEPROM.
Rename the file if needed and select the save path.
The left panel will display a successful read message after completion.
Step 7. Write the ECU Data
Write INT FLASH
Tap Write INT FLASH.
Select the data file to write.
Tap Yes when prompted.
Wait until the writing process is completed successfully.
Write EXT EEPROM
Tap Write EXT EEPROM.
Select the data file.
Wait for the writing process to complete successfully.
Step 8. Disconnect
After all operations are completed, tap Disconnect to end the session.
